Transaction 58f1a3ab3cb7876605163d02d68519136b22345f1ffa8a032d7a3a2db9467c68
1 Input
1 Output
-
58f1a3ab3cb7876605163d02d68519136b22345f1ffa8a032d7a3a2db9467c68:0
- value
- 17437
- script pubkey
- OP_0 OP_PUSHBYTES_20 11ce62b4bc7690a0a639056b6d6ab0acf71fadf9
- address
- bc1qz88x9d9uw6g2pf3eq44k664s4nm3lt0ekhpvdk